In PRESENT/TENSE comedian Nathan DArcy Roberts (The Emily Atack Show, The Lenny Henry Show, Horrible Histories, winner of BBCs prestigious Felix Dexter bursary, twice nominated for the BBC New Comedy Award) takes an analytic look at his life. An hour of stand-up comedy full of observations and anecdotes touching on issues that his therapist has described as funny, relatable, and unresolved.
What is it about McDonalds that turns civilised people savage? How did he learn of a family members incarceration via a BBC Three documentary? Whats the venues wi-fi password? Nathan will endeavour to answer all these questions and more!
